ulcerative colitis is not a form of cancer. However if you have had
extensive or total colitis for many years,
you have a greater risk than normal of developing cancer
in the colon or rectum. It is possible todevelop dysplasia (pre-cancerous
changes) before the growth of an actual tumour. By lookingfor these changes
during a colonoscopy (see How
is UC diagnosed?), the doctor can checkwhether it is
advisable to have surgery to remove the colon. If you have had extensive UC foreight
years or more it is advisable to speak to your doctor. We have an Information
